1050A Aluminum: Chemical Composition and Characteristics
1050A metal is a industrial metal alloy primarily made of almost 100% alu with limited quantities of foreign components. Its chemical composition typically incorporates under 0.5% regarding magnesium, silicon, iron, and copper. This cleanliness causes in superb rust resistance, fine workability, and high electrical conductivity. The weight is around 2.7 g/cm³, and it exhibits sufficient weldability.

Aluminum 1050A: Applications in Manufacturing
Al Alloy finds wide use in several fabrication processes . Its excellent corrosion property and adequate ductility allow it appropriate for creating sheet metal . Common functions encompass chemical vessels , lamp reflectors , kitchen utensils and signage structures. Moreover, its lightweight nature provides to energy performance in shipping industries.
